IoT – surely, you have heard of it!
The Internet of Things is a network of physical objects equipped with sensors, software and networking capabilities that can collect or share data via the internet. Think home appliances, vehicles, industrial machinery among other things. These gadgets can monitor surroundings, automate tasks and overall increase productivity, making them a hit in the tech world in recent times.

Trend 1: The Internet Of Blockchain Things
Since its inception, blockchain has been a game-changer. Owing to its decentralized nature, it will change the face of IoT applications in 2025. This enhanced protection offered by blockchain ensures data security across interconnected devices.
Recently, Markets and Markets reported that the global blockchain IoT market is projected to grow by USD 2,409 million by 2026 across industries like finance, agriculture and transportation. Even Walmart, the retail giant, has implemented blockchain IoT to improve its supply chain transparency and food safety, reflecting IoT recent trends in retail innovation. It also plans to have 65% of its stores serviced by IoT automation by 2026!
Adam Draper, the founder of Boost VC, has an interesting take on this trend, saying “The blockchain does one thing: It replaces third-party trust with mathematical proof that something happened.”
Hence, SMEs are predicted to leverage blockchain in combination with IoT to reshape industries across verticals by automating secure data exchange, aligning with the emerging trends in IoT. In 2025, the synergy between blockchain and IoT will grow exponentially due to its ability to manage safe and scalable systems.

Trend 2: Modern Traffic Needs Modern Solutions
Yes, we’re talking about smart traffic! Recently, we've seen IoT integrated into smart traffic systems equipped with IoT sensors in vehicles and road networks to address global traffic challenges. McKinsey predicts that by 2025, cities implementing smart-mobility technologies could reduce travel times by 15-20%, improving the daily commute for millions and creating an efficient urban environment.
Smart cities are not a distant reality but are up and running worldwide. However, with variables such as 5G connectivity, enhancements in AI/ML and advances in infrastructure, we will see smart mobility solutions powered by IoT become the key pillars to reducing congestion and enhancing the quality of life in cities. Moreover, the integration of Vehicle-to-Everything (V2X) in modern vehicles will take a large chunk of the cake in 2025. V2X is a technology where a vehicle can share information from its sensors, cameras and internal systems with other vehicles, nearby pedestrians, road infrastructure and even smart city systems using wireless data connectivity. Yup, it’s like IoT but on a city-wide scale, which means IoT will have a large impact on Smart City infrastructure and development plans.
For instance, Barcelona was one of the first cities to lead the charge in 2012 by leveraging its 500 kilometers of fiber optic cable. The city uses IoT sensors embedded in traffic lights, parking spaces and road networks to optimize traffic flow and reduce congestion.

Trend 3: Digital Twin In IoT Will Be A Win
First gaining recognition in 2020, Digital Twins are no young kids around the block. In 2025, we will see Digital Twins transforming asset optimization by creating real-time virtual counterparts of physical objects - like creating a replica of the Mona Lisa for your Saturday art class. By providing real-time data and feedback, this integration will help businesses optimize IoT-based processes and enhance the efficiency of digital deployments.
Fortune Business Insights reveals that the digital twin market is projected to grow from USD 6.75 billion in 2021 to USD 96.49 billion by 2029, with a CAGR of 40.6%. A great example of its integration with IoT is in pharma and life sciences, specifically how they are staying ahead of the curve. Digital twins are being used extensively to provide real-time insights into medical processes and virtual versions of biomedical systems.
Right from successful scaling to commercial launches, the meticulous integration of technology and biology makes IoT-based digital twins especially valuable. By simulating biological processes within the human body, they support medical research and the development and testing of new treatments. By deploying a virtual twin of a physical object that uses real-time data from IoT sensors, businesses will be able to simulate a vast variety of case-wise behavior, enhance performance and monitor operations.

Trend 4: Voice-Activated IoT Devices Will Be The New Rage
Alexa, how’s the traffic outside today? Well, it could be better if it’s IoT-managed. As seen in other trends as well, voice search is becoming increasingly popular and voice-activated IoT devices are on the rise with 27% of the global population using voice search. In 2025, voice-enabled IoT devices will make a splash with their convenience and robust capabilities.
Voice-activated assistants like Google Alexa, Amazon Echo and Apple Siri have elevated voice-based interfaces for consumers. Yet, early adopters in businesses such as retailers and fintech leaders are already adopting and using voice and speech recognition to enhance customer experiences. Now, using IoT-based sensors will help them provide more seamless interactions through smart devices. Moreover, voice biometry is seen as an emerging security method for authentication, analyzing specific vocal traits like pitch and tone to create digital voice profiles (remember Richie Rich and his family singing to get into the vault?)
Capital One is a glowing example of this adoption of smart devices with voice capabilities. As an early tech adopter, they introduced ENO, their voice-enabled smart virtual assistant. The voice-enabled assistant created a more human-centric approach for their clients, leading to more loyalty and AI-powered interactions.

Trend 5: AI And IoT, The Power Couple
Hey, can we complete a trend without AI? We think not! After all, the global AIoT market was valued at USD 5.09 Billion in 2023 and will grow at a CAGR of 37.7% from 2024 to 2033. The combination of IoT and AI is the driving force behind Wakanda-level tech advancements. These two technologies will complement each other, enabling industries to develop smart machines that automate tasks and reduce human intervention in 2025. You see, IoT sensors provide data, while its trusty AI processes it to optimize the outcome!
AIOT is making waves already but will be even more powerful in 2025, with better AI models. Moreover, 5G networks will help businesses provide secure and high-performance bandwidth connectivity between their IoT networks and AI models in the cloud. With dedicated processing at the edge, AIoT will reshape human-machine interactions in the workplace.
For instance, Siemens has leveraged IoT-enabled AI in its manufacturing process through its MindSphere platform, which connects IoT devices across its factories with real-time data. Then they used AI to analyze the data, helping them optimize production, automate machinery, predict maintenance, reduce downtime and increase productivity. Experts predict that in 2025 the integration of AI and IoT will be crucial for creating intelligent automation systems that streamline operations across industries.

Frequently Asked Questions
What are the 4 types of IoT?
The Internet of Things (IoT) encompasses various categories, including Consumer IoT (CIoT) for personal devices like smartphones and wearables; Commercial IoT for applications in healthcare and retail; Industrial IoT (IIoT) for manufacturing and industrial processes; and Infrastructure IoT for smart cities and transportation systems.
What are the future trends in IoT?
Future IoT trends include the integration of artificial intelligence for enhanced data analysis, the expansion of 5G networks to support increased connectivity, a focus on security measures to protect data, and the development of smart cities utilizing IoT for efficient urban management.
What is the future of IoT in 2030?
By 2030, IoT is projected to enable $5.5 trillion to $12.6 trillion in global economic value, with applications spanning smart homes, healthcare, agriculture, and industrial automation, significantly transforming daily life and business operations.
